Mini split systems, also called ductless mini splits, are a new way to control the temperature in your home. They are unlike traditional central air systems, as they do not require complicated ductwork.
A mini-split system has two main components: the outdoor unit, which has the compressor and condenser, and the second part, which includes one or more indoor units in the rooms you want to cool or heat.
The indoor units can be installed on walls or ceilings. They help cool or heat the air in those spaces. A small conduit connects the indoor units to the outdoor unit. This conduit carries the refrigerant lines and wiring. This setup looks tidy and simple.
The clever design of mini splits allows them to control the temperature effectively in various areas. A key part of the system is the outdoor compressor. It moves refrigerant between the indoor and outdoor units to change the heat.
When cooling, the refrigerant takes in heat from inside and gives it off outside. When heating, the refrigerant collects heat from outside and brings it inside.
Indoor air handling units keep the air comfortable inside. Each unit has its thermostat. This lets you set different temperatures for each room. That is what makes mini splits special. You can choose the right temperature you like. They also save energy by only heating or cooling the rooms you use.
Homeowners are becoming more interested in HVAC mini split systems for new constructions. These systems have several benefits. One big advantage is energy efficiency.
Mini split systems do not use ductwork, which can waste energy in regular systems. Instead of heating or cooling the whole house, mini split systems target specific areas, similar to space heaters. This means less energy waste and lower energy bills.
Ductless heat pump systems help you feel comfortable and in control. Each indoor unit can work by itself. This allows you to set different temperatures in every room. Everyone can enjoy the temperature they like best. Say goodbye to arguments about the heat at home.
The talk about mini splits and traditional HVAC systems often focuses on ductwork. Conventional HVAC systems use ducts to carry air to different areas of a home. They do a good job, but there are times when ducts waste energy.
This happens often when ducts go through attics or crawl spaces that are unconditioned spaces and aren't temperature controlled. The energy lost in these areas is called "duct losses." This can reduce how well these systems work and lead to higher energy bills.
Mini split systems are unique because they do not use ducts. They directly send cool or warm air to certain areas. This helps to waste less energy. As a result, your energy bill will focus on heating or cooling the rooms you use.

Choosing the right mini split heating system for your home is essential. It keeps you comfy and helps the system run smoothly. Like any heating or cooling system, the right size is crucial. A system that is too small won't make your home feel good. A system that is too big will turn on and off often. This can waste energy.
Getting help from a skilled HVAC expert can help you choose the correct size and type of mini split system. They will check several things. This includes the size of your rooms, how well they are insulated, and what you need for climate control.
